About The Position

Reporting to the IFRS Director and Actuary, Corporate Actuarial, the candidate assumes actuarial corporate duties in order to meet the departmental objectives. Requirements

  • University degree in actuarial or in mathematics
  • Associate of the Society of Actuaries (ASA) and/or Canadian Institute of Actuaries (ACIA)
  • Strong knowledge and interest for computer & software skills, MS Office, VBA, SQL, Oracle
  • Minimum of 4 years of related professional experience
  • Good knowledge of the AXIS and RiskIntegrity software

Nice To Haves

  • Knowledge of IFRS and LDTI standards, an asset

Responsibilities

  • Be one of the key person in the preparation and explanation of the IFRS 17 financial statements and other actuarial reports
  • Assist in the US GAAP monthly valuation exercise
  • Validate the data used in the actuarial calculation and produce the external & internal verification reports
  • Assist in the preparation of the actuarial report (Appointed Actuary Report) and other regulatory reports
  • Support the production of financial projections and collaborate in the analysis and production of reports
  • Represents the Corporate Actuarial department on certain projects
  • Participate, by using software tools, in the preparation of the necessary actuarial evaluations
  • Ensure the integrity of the databases used
  • Maintain the systems up to date which serve for calculations and projections
